President Leonel Fernandez met with social security system stakeholders at the Presidential Palace yesterday. During the meeting he had praise for the first year of implementation of the National Family Health Plan. As reported in Hoy, he observed that there had been significant advances in coverage, 87% service satisfaction and financial sustainability of the system. He announced that the plan has a surplus of RD$3 billion and receives RD$14 billion a month in contributions from paying affiliates. Affiliates received RD$8 billion in benefits in the first year and the number of affiliates is up 30%. By law, companies are obliged to affiliate their full-time employees. President Fernandez admitted some weaknesses that included overcharging for some services, lack of information and levying of charges that are not legally justifiable. Representing the government at the meeting were Vice President Rafael Alburquerque, Health Minister Bautista Rojas Gomez, Essential Drugs Program (Promese) director Elena Fernadez, the director of the Health Sector Reform Commission Humberto Salazar, among others.
